The Epworth Hall
Built in the early 1900’s, the Epworth Hall is the prefect blend of classical architecture and modern design.
With a theatre capacity of 100 and cabaret capacity of 70, the hall is perfect for daytime social events and presentations. The room is always bright and open, and has perfect connections to our smaller breakout rooms for larger organisations.
The Studio
Our mezzanine level studio is the perfect secluded space for smaller, more intimate events.
With a theatre capacity of 60 and boardroom capacity of 28, the room works perfectly for workshops and training seminars, or as a breakout for a larger event.
